Dodgers Start Season 3-0 with Home Opener Win Highlighted by Ohtani's Key Homer
Shohei Ohtani's seventh-inning home run and Blake Snell's pitching debut helped secure a 5-4 victory over the Tigers in front of a sellout crowd in Los Angeles.
- Shohei Ohtani hit his second home run of the season in the seventh inning, providing a critical insurance run in the Dodgers' 5-4 win over the Tigers.
- Blake Snell made his Dodgers debut, pitching five innings and allowing two runs to earn the win in the home opener.
- Teoscar Hernández's three-run homer in the fifth inning gave the Dodgers a 4-2 lead after briefly trailing the Tigers.
- Blake Treinen secured the save in the ninth inning, navigating a tense situation with two Tigers on base and one out.
- The game featured a celebratory atmosphere with a sellout crowd of 53,595, a pregame trophy presentation, and Hollywood stars like Tom Hanks and Rob Lowe in attendance.
